Monolith Soft did a little technical article about the new software techniques they're using at the studio.
They're using Houdini to generate geometry on a massive scale without the need to manually designing large scenes by hand. They showed off generative creation of terrain detail as well as a cityscape.
I expect whatever games they've been working on will have a gigantic shift in sense of scale compared to their existing games (which already have an amazing sense of scale).
